Been slowly ticking a few bits off the to do list roof rack on and engine is running after a few teething issues with the DBW & injection system
Initially had too small cc injectors and couldn't get the injector opening times to work but fitted 1.8T 290cc golf injectors and runs so much better, Still needs dyno mapping but pretty happy with it so far
